Wolves shackle Minot State 38-9

MINOT, N.D. –
Northern State claimed two open weight classes and gave up one of their own, but dropped just one of the seven remaining contested matches on Wednesday to take a 38-9 victory over the host Minot State Beavers.
 
With the non-conference win, NSU moves to 7-7 in dual meets.
 
The Wolves started and ended the night with wins by fall.  Blake Lundgren kicked off the night with a quick pin at 165 pounds.  Senior Donnie Bowden followed with a major decision that vaulted the Wolves out to a 10-0 lead.
 
The Beavers got on the board at 184 pounds, picking up a forfeit win that made it 10-6.  That, however, would be as close as they got.  The Wolves reeled off four straight wins, including two open weights at 285 and 133 pounds.  Those, combined with a Baker Haar major decision and an Anthony Bruno win, stretched the Wolves' lead to 29-6 and effectively sealed the team win.
 
Minot State broke the NSU streak and got back on the board with an overtime win at 141 pounds.  Tyler Frost picked up two late stalling calls against his opponent to force the match into overtime, but was unable to avoid the takedown in the sudden-death overtime period.
 
Gavin Larsen and Neil Sell capped the evening for the Wolves, Larson with a 3-0 shutout at 149 pounds and Sell with a win by fall in 2:08 to make the final score 38-9.
 
NSU closes out the dual portion of the 2011-12 season tomorrow, taking on the University of Mary in an NSIC dual.  Action on the mat begins at 7 p.m. in Bismarck.
